hello sir/mam,

i m purchasing some material inclusive of vat and thereon an amount of subsidy is also given by the suplier.

i want to know that whather should i take the whole input VAT credit or propotionate VAT on material cost after subtracting the subsidy theron?

e.g.
material cost 1200
VAT theron 48 ( @ 4%)

total price 1248

let subsidy 624

net amount payble to suplier 624

now i have two opinion.
1:-

Input VAT credit will be 24 {i.e.(1248-624)*0.04/1.04}

and the second one:-
Input VAT credit will be 48 {i.e.(1248*0.04/1.04} means the whole Input VAT.

what should i do???

As per VAT rules related to Input Vat Credit, full credit is available if following conditions are fulfilled:

  1. "TAX INVOICE" is printed on purchase invoice
  2. VAT amount is shown separately
  3. VAT TIN of supplier is mentioned

It needs to be verified that the purchase transaction is not covered in the negative list & there is no provision related to reduction of VAT credit.

In ur case, prima facie, u can claim Rs. 48/- as Input VAT credit as the supplier has collected VAT of Rs. 48/- & is giving subsidy after collecting VAT.
